Output 306082b3123986f4bef4fb087b9b3198e97a47d81e0a0057ffa8603e4d081867:19

value
7901440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e7f63adc7f46103cf8139f97b9bf88b3e0c621 OP_EQUAL
address
3PeoyaF1JrFiQxiT6sAfhniGNwNnVgMbSR
transaction
306082b3123986f4bef4fb087b9b3198e97a47d81e0a0057ffa8603e4d081867
confirmations
265847
spent
true